MATRIARCH—OSTENTATIOUS—INSCRUTABLE
You go to the Windswept Plateau to find peace. Peace is present in the calm sunset and bamboo hues of the Zephyr Steppes, where the altitude is low enough to escape the whirring and swishing of the zealous spiral and skydancer dragons in the Reedcleft Ascent. Here the breeze is gentle and warm, and here the hatchlings hesitantly take flight, filling the air with the unabashed laughter of youth. You go to the Windswept Plateau to find peace, but today you find a face full of pink feathers; today you are swiftly thrown off balance by a small but forceful something. When you emerge from the bamboo bushes, your gaze is met by that of a small fae dragon. She disrupts the muted shades of the plateau with the loud vividness of her pink and rose tones. She blinks at you expressionlessly with her head tilted sideways, yet her ever-expressive crest twitches to and fro. A petal jumper trembles on top of her pretty pink neck bow, twirling a violet petal between its legs. The familiar's purple eyes assess you inquisitively. Your gaze darts between the fae and the petal jumper. Your body aches from the impact of your fall. You are full of anticipation, somehow. "Oh," says the fae. The wings of the petal jumper quiver. "You were in my way." A calm breeze stirs the fae's rose-feathered wings. Her claws dig into the dirt. You feel your expression morph into a new one, the corners of your mouth inching downward and the crease between your brows deepening. You create your new expression in vain; nothing evokes emotion from the dragon before you, and the only reaction comes from her crest frills, which shudders sporadically yet gives you no indication of her mood. You open your mouth to speak, but your words are caught on the breeze. After a moment's pause, the fae takes flight. A storm of rose feathers scatters in the wind, and the fae's pink body flutters away toward the Cloudsong. The Zephyr Steppes are orange, green, and peaceful once more, and the fae's spell is over; the soreness in your limbs subsides, your brow slowly unknits itself, and the corners of your mouth stretch lazily outward. A single violet petal twirls softly in the summer breeze. |
Petal is the unlikely matriarch of clan Corona. It must be obvious that she never quite planned to be a leader; rather, she always considered herself first and foremost to be a collector of "pretty things." In the first weeks of her existence, this meant that she hoarded a variety of shiny, fluffy, and all-around gaudy apparel items for dressing up. Soon enough the shining scales of her fellow dragons began to catch her eye, so now she collects clan members as well.
It would be a mistake to assume that Petal is superficial. If you could understand the ruffling and swaying and twitching of her expressive crest, you would find that she has a heart for much more than her aesthetic. Though it was difficult for her clan members to understand her at first, they soon began to see that — despite her frankness and her blankness — she is actually quite an adept leader. Being a fae dragon, she has an acute sense of the magical and emotional auras surrounding her clan members. Her lack of skill with words translates (surprisingly) into fantastic leadership; by using candid and objective opinions, she can quickly end any arguments or difficulties that may arise. It must be a surprise for anyone to learn that her mate is Melliorn. Petal believes in the objectivity of beauty, and if you ask her, Melliorn is objectively hideous — not to mention Melliorn's unfortunate color scheme of avocado and silver. Yet Petal would also say that you can't place bows or feathers or petals on love, and when asked, the only explanation she has for her choice of mate is a simple spasm of her crest. Petal spends most of her days flying about doing whatever suits her fancy. As a member of the wind flight, she is rather... well, flighty. Some days she hunts for shiny things; some days she worries over the clan's hatchlings; and some days she tags along with the hunters and tries not to get blood on her pretty pink bows. Petal's tendency to wander is precisely how she stumbles upon new clan members, charming them with her unusual personality. It is truly a wonder that such a peculiar leader with such peculiar habits can lead a clan. But we must all keep in mind that faes are known for their magic — and maybe her success is simply magical.
